Bluetooth Enabled 3D Glasses Become an Additional Link in the Wirelessly Connected Living Room
Home entertainment devices, led by gaming consoles, have been migrating to Bluetooth wireless connections to remove the requirement of line-of-site while still providing a secure, efficient and robust wireless link. Car Connectivity Consortium Surpasses 50 Member Mark, Grows 50% in Q1 2012
The Car Connectivity Consortium (CCC), today announced it has surpassed the 50 member mark. Having grown 50 percent in the first quarter of 2012 alone, and representing 70 percent of automotive and 70 percent of smartphone markets worldwide, the milestone represents a sharp increase in momentum for the MirrorLink standard. P4A Combines New Panasonic Flat Screen PCS & Movicon CE to Deliver Low Cost, Windows™ CE-based Scada Package.
Products 4 Automation (P4A) has concluded an agreement with Panasonic, under which P4A will distribute the Panasonic GN series of flat panel PCs running P4A’s Movicon CE™ software, the most powerful HMI platform currently available for Windows™ CE. The combined package is compact, and capable of satisfying every user need, in terms of visualisation and control, without any compromises as regards full blown SCADA systems.
